Several key factors are propelling the growth of the silicon nasal cannula market. The rising prevalence of chronic respiratory illnesses, such as chronic obstructive pulmonary disease (COPD), asthma, and cystic fibrosis, significantly increases the demand for effective oxygen delivery systems. The aging global population further exacerbates this trend, as older individuals are more susceptible to respiratory complications. Technological advancements in cannula design, focusing on improved comfort, ease of use, and enhanced oxygen delivery, are also contributing significantly to market growth. The development of more biocompatible and durable silicon materials ensures patient comfort and reduces the risk of skin irritation or allergic reactions, increasing patient satisfaction and compliance. Furthermore, the increasing adoption of home healthcare settings and the growing preference for convenient, at-home respiratory support are key drivers. This shift reduces the burden on hospitals and healthcare facilities, enabling patients to receive treatment in the familiar environment of their homes. The rising healthcare expenditure globally, particularly in developing nations, is also positively impacting market growth, enabling wider access to advanced medical devices like silicon nasal cannulas. Finally, favorable regulatory policies and government initiatives promoting better respiratory care are accelerating the market expansion.
Despite the promising growth outlook, the silicon nasal cannula market faces certain challenges. One primary concern is the potential for skin irritation and discomfort, particularly with prolonged use. While improvements in material science are mitigating this issue, it remains a factor influencing patient compliance. The market is also susceptible to fluctuations in raw material prices, impacting the overall cost of production and potentially influencing pricing strategies. Stringent regulatory requirements and compliance procedures in various countries can pose a significant barrier to market entry for new players, particularly smaller companies. Competition from alternative oxygen delivery systems, such as oxygen masks and non-invasive ventilation devices, also presents a challenge. Moreover, the potential for counterfeit products flooding the market raises concerns about safety and quality, affecting both patient care and market integrity. Finally, the variations in healthcare infrastructure and reimbursement policies across different regions can create complexities in market penetration and growth. Addressing these challenges requires continued innovation in material science, robust quality control measures, and strategic market expansion plans by manufacturers.
